The basics

What it covers: The physical Earth — plate tectonics, volcanoes, earthquakes, atmosphere, global wind patterns, watersheds, and soil.

Exam weight: About 10–15% of the AP Environmental Science exam — heavily weighted.

The big question: How do Earth's physical systems (geology, atmosphere, water, soil) interact to shape the environment that life depends on?

Big Ideas covered: Interactions Between Earth Systems (ERT), Energy Transfer (ENG).

Key topics at a glance

Plate Boundaries

Convergent (collide, subduction, mountains), divergent (pull apart, new crust), transform (slide past, earthquakes).

Volcanoes & Earthquakes

Both concentrated at plate boundaries. Volcanic ash/SO2 can cool global climate temporarily. Earthquakes from sudden stress release on faults.

Atmospheric Layers

Troposphere (weather, 0–12 km), stratosphere (ozone layer, UV protection, 12–50 km).

Global Wind Patterns

Driven by uneven solar heating (equator vs. poles) and the Coriolis effect (Earth's rotation curving wind direction). Circulation cells (Hadley, Ferrel, polar) set where deserts and rainforests form.

Solar Radiation & Seasons

Earth's 23.5° axial tilt, not distance from the Sun, causes the seasons. The equator receives the most concentrated, year-round solar energy.

Geography & Climate

Latitude, elevation, ocean currents, and the rain-shadow effect (dry leeward side of mountains) shape a region's climate.

El Niño & La Niña (ENSO)

El Niño weakens trade winds and warms the eastern Pacific, cutting upwelling and fisheries off South America; La Niña is the opposite, cooler phase.

Watersheds

Land area draining into one water body. Land use anywhere in a watershed affects water quality downstream.

Soil Formation

Five factors: climate, parent rock, topography, organisms, time. Produces distinct horizons: O, A (topsoil), B, C, R.

Soil Properties

Texture (sand/silt/clay ratio), porosity (empty pore space), permeability (water flow rate) — all determine agricultural suitability.

Soil Erosion

Wind/water strip topsoil; worsened by deforestation, overgrazing, tillage. Prevented by contour plowing, terracing, no-till, cover crops.
